Pepz Pizza - S. Brookhurst St.

646 S Brookhurst St, Anaheim, CA
Pepz Pizza - S. Brookhurst St. Pepz Pizza - S. Brookhurst St. is one of the popular American Restaurant located in 646 S Brookhurst St ,Anaheim listed under American Restaurant in Anaheim , Pizza Place in Anaheim ,

Contact Details & Working Hours

Map of Pepz Pizza - S. Brookhurst St.